Marshall report on behalf of the Swift-XRT team:\n\nWe have analysed 12 ks of XRT data for GRB 120102A (Marshall  et al.\nGCN Circ. 12794), from 119 s to 34.6 ks after the  BAT trigger. The\ndata comprise 240 s in Windowed Timing (WT) mode with the remainder in\nPhoton Counting (PC) mode. The enhanced XRT position for this burst was\ngiven by Beardmore et al. (GCN. Circ 12795).\n\nThe late-time light curve (from T0+4.5 ks) can be modelled with an\ninitial power-law decay with an index of alpha=1.99 (+0.27, -0.11),\nfollowed by a break at T+13.0 ks to an alpha of 0.97 (+0.27, -0.22).\n\nA spectrum formed from the PC mode data can be fitted with an absorbed\npower-law with a photon spectral index of 2.04 (+/-0.08). The\nbest-fitting absorption column is  2.59 (+0.26, -0.25) x 10^21 cm^-2,\nin excess of the Galactic value of 1.0 x 10^21 cm^-2 (Kalberla et al.\n2005). The counts to observed (unabsorbed) 0.3-10 keV flux conversion\nfactor deduced from this spectrum  is 4.0 x 10^-11 (6.2 x 10^-11) erg\ncm^-2 count^-1. \n\nA summary of the PC-mode spectrum is thus:\nTotal column:\t     2.59 (+0.26, -0.25) x 10^21 cm^-2\nGalactic foreground: 1.0 x 10^21 cm^-2\nExcess significance: 10.3 sigma\nPhoton index:\t     2.04 (+/-0.08)\n\nThe results of the XRT-team automatic analysis are available at\nhttp://www.swift.ac.uk/xrt_products/00510922.\n\nThis circular is an official product of the Swift-XRT team.",
